Frequently Asked Questions

1. What is the average cost of health insurance in Dillwyn?

Health insurance premiums vary, but residents can expect to pay between $300 and $600 monthly, based on coverage levels.

2. Are there local clinics available?

Yes, Dillwyn has local clinics that offer preventive care and minor treatments, often at lower costs than hospitals.

3. How much do routine check-ups cost?

Routine check-ups typically cost between $100 and $150, with some clinics offering sliding scale fees based on income.

4. Is dental care expensive in Dillwyn?

Dental care can be expensive, with cleanings averaging $80 to $150. Dental insurance can help mitigate these costs.
